Arquitetura em nuvem: Desvendando AWS, Azure e Google Cloud para iniciantes

COMPARTILHAR

A arquitetura em nuvem revolucionou a forma como empresas e desenvolvedores abordam a infraestrutura de TI. Com opções como AWS, Azure e Google Cloud, as possibilidades de escalar e gerenciar recursos se tornaram mais eficientes e acessíveis. Porém, para quem está começando, essa infinidade de opções pode parecer confusa. Nesta matéria, vamos explorar os principais conceitos de cada uma dessas plataformas, suas funcionalidades e como escolher a que melhor se adapta às suas necessidades.

A computação em nuvem permite que empresas de todos os tamanhos aproveitem recursos computacionais sob demanda, sem a necessidade de investimento em hardware físico. Por isso, entender as diferenças entre AWS, Azure e Google Cloud é crucial para qualquer profissional de TI ou empreendedor que deseja adotar soluções em nuvem. Vamos desvendar esses serviços e ajudá-lo a tomar decisões informadas!


O que estudar em 2025 para ser um desenvolvedor disputado?

Carreira em Data Science: O que é preciso para ser um cientista de dados?


O que é computação em nuvem? 💻

Computação em nuvem refere-se ao fornecimento de serviços de computação — armazenamento, processamento, bancos de dados, criando soluções personalizadas ou aplicativos sob demanda — pela internet, ou "nuvem". Isso permite que as empresas acessem e gerenciem seus recursos de forma mais flexível e escalável.

O que estudar em 2025 para ser um desenvolvedor disputado?


Principais provedores de nuvem ☁️

Os três maiores provedores de serviços em nuvem são:

  1. Amazon Web Services (AWS): O pioneiro no mercado de nuvem, que oferece uma ampla gama de serviços.
  2. Microsoft Azure: Famoso por sua integração com outras ferramentas da Microsoft e seu foco em empresas.
  3. Google Cloud: Conhecido pela sua infraestrutura poderosa e ferramentas de análise de dados.


Vantagens da arquitetura em nuvem.

Utilizar uma arquitetura em nuvem traz diversas vantagens, tais como:

  • Escalabilidade: Adapte a quantidade de recursos de acordo com a demanda.
  • Custo-efetividade: Pague apenas pelo que usar, evitando investimentos altos em infraestrutura.
  • Acessibilidade: Acesse os serviços de qualquer lugar com conexão à internet.


AWS: O que você precisa saber.

A AWS, criada pela Amazon, é um dos serviços de nuvem mais amplamente adotados. Algumas de suas características incluem:

  1. Funcionalidades amplas: Oferece serviços que vão desde computação e armazenamento até inteligência artificial e segurança.
  2. Modelo de preços flexível: Possui várias opções de pagamento para atender diferentes orçamentos.
  3. Documentação abrangente: Possui uma vasta documentação e comunidade ativa que pode ajudar novos usuários.


Azure: Integrando-se ao ecossistema Microsoft.

O Azure da Microsoft se destaca pela sua integração com outras soluções da Microsoft, como o Office 365 e o Dynamics. Veja o que é importante:

  1. Serviços híbridos: Permite fácil transição entre nuvem e infraestrutura local.
  2. Foco em soluções empresariais: É preferido por muitas grandes empresas pela sua confiabilidade.
  3. Inteligência Artificial: Serviços avançados para machine learning e análise de dados.


Google Cloud: Potência em dados e machine learning.

O Google Cloud é conhecido por sua infraestrutura robusta, ideal para aplicações que exigem processamento intensivo de dados. Suas principais vantagens incluem:

  1. Big Data e Machine Learning: Ferramentas poderosas para analisar grandes volumes de dados.
  2. Conectividade global: A infraestrutura do Google permite alta performance em qualquer lugar do mundo.
  3. Foco em desenvolvedores: Oferece várias APIs e ferramentas que facilitam o desenvolvimento e gerenciamento de aplicativos.


Como escolher entre AWS, Azure e Google Cloud? 🤔

A escolha entre AWS, Azure e Google Cloud depende de vários fatores:

  1. Objetivos do projeto: O que você pretende alcançar com a nuvem?
  2. Orçamento: Qual é o seu limite de investimento?
  3. Experiência da equipe: Sua equipe já está familiarizada com alguma dessas plataformas?
  4. Necessidades específicas: Exige serviços especiais ou ferramentas de inteligência artificial?


Perguntas frequentes sobre arquitetura em nuvem.

  • A arquitetura em nuvem é segura?

Sim, a maioria dos provedores oferece ferramentas de segurança robustas, mas a segurança também depende da configuração correta e do uso das melhores práticas.

  • Posso migrar meus dados facilmente entre AWS, Azure e Google Cloud?

Sim, porém, a migração entre serviços pode envolver complexidades, como compatibilidade de formatos e tempo de inatividade.

  • Qual a diferença entre IaaS, PaaS e SaaS?
  • IaaS (Infrastructure as a Service): Oferece infraestrutura de TIC virtualizada.
  • PaaS (Platform as a Service): Fornece uma plataforma para o desenvolvimento e execução de aplicativos.
  • SaaS (Software as a Service): Fornece aplicativos que podem ser usados diretamente pela internet.


Considerações finais.

Dominar os conceitos de arquitetura em nuvem é essencial para qualquer profissional de tecnologia que deseje se manter relevante no mercado. Conhecer as características de AWS, Azure e Google Cloud não só ajudará em uma decisão informada sobre qual provedor escolher, mas também permitirá que você explore um mundo de possibilidades de inovação e eficiência. Esteja preparado para se adaptar e aproveitar ao máximo os benefícios que a nuvem pode oferecer! 🌻

0 Comentários